Grande moved to the number one spot on November 15th and has been holding steady there. It looks as if from here on out it is going to be a shootout between Grande and newcomer Ava Max. Max stayed at number two on the weekend. The question really is whether or not Grande is going to start dropping away while Max, with her song “Sweet But Psycho” is still on the rise.

This is Max’s breakout smash hit and behind her in third place on the weekend, Halsey held ground with “Without Me”. That is as high as it has gotten but has remained there for the last two rounds of chart action. That probably suggests that Halsey isn’t going to have quite enough legs to go all the way and top the charts.

X Factor winner Dalton Harry and James Arthur have both seen their respective features slip away over the weekend. Then there is Mariah Carey who jumped up a spot to fifth on Sunday. It’s one of the most popular Christmas songs ever and the poppy tune is back on the charge. A couple of weeks ago it fired up from 34th into the top ten and it is still rising.
